    Day 1: Rio de Janeiro  Arrive in Rio de Janeiro, where your private driver will meet you at the international airport and transfer you to your hotel.  The remainder of the day is free to relax or explore. Enjoy Rio’s famous beaches, including Copacabana, Ipanema and Leblon, with their lively promenades, golden sands and beautiful ocean views.

    Day 2: Rio de Janeiro – Corcovado & Christ the Redeemer  After breakfast, enjoy a half-day excursion to Corcovado Mountain. Take the scenic train through the Tijuca rainforest to the summit, where you’ll visit the iconic Christ the Redeemer statue. From the top, enjoy spectacular panoramic views of Rio, Guanabara Bay, Sugarloaf Mountain and the surrounding landscape.

    Day 3: Rio de Janeiro – Sugarloaf Mountain After breakfast, visit Sugarloaf Mountain. Take the cable car to Urca Mountain and continue to Sugarloaf for breathtaking views over Rio, Copacabana Beach, Guanabara Bay and Christ the Redeemer.  The tour continues with a panoramic drive through the city before returning to your hotel.

    Day 4: Rio de Janeiro – Foz do Iguaçu Breakfast and transfer to the airport for your flight to Foz do Iguaçu. Upon arrival, meet your driver and transfer to your hotel.  Foz do Iguaçu is home to the spectacular Iguaçu Falls, surrounded by the lush rainforest of Iguaçu National Park. The falls consist of hundreds of cascades, including the impressive Devil’s Throat.

    Day 5: Foz do Iguaçu – Brazilian Falls  After breakfast, visit the Brazilian side of Iguaçu Falls. Follow the scenic walkways along the canyon and enjoy views of the many waterfalls, culminating at the spectacular Devil’s Throat.

    Day 6: Foz do Iguaçu – Argentinean Falls – Buenos Aires After breakfast, explore the Argentinean side of Iguaçu National Park, offering a different perspective of the falls. Walk the Lower and Upper Circuits and take the ecological train to Devil’s Throat for an unforgettable close-up experience.  After the tour, transfer to the airport for your flight to Buenos Aires. Upon arrival, meet your driver and transfer to your hotel.  Buenos Aires is a vibrant, cosmopolitan city famous for its tango, historic neighborhoods, elegant architecture and lively cultural scene.

    Day 7: Buenos Aires – City Tour & Tango Dinner After breakfast, enjoy a half-day city tour highlighting Buenos Aires’ major landmarks, including 9 de Julio Avenue, the Obelisk, Plaza de Mayo, Casa Rosada, San Telmo, La Boca, Recoleta, Palermo and Puerto Madero.  In the evening, enjoy a Tango Show with Dinner, featuring talented dancers, musicians and singers performing this passionate symbol of Buenos Aires.

    Day 8: Buenos Aires – Lima  After breakfast, transfer to the international airport for your flight to Lima, Peru. Upon arrival, transfer to your hotel.

    Day 9: Lima – City Tour  After breakfast, enjoy a guided tour of Lima’s historic and modern highlights. Visit the Main Square, Cathedral and San Francisco Convent, with its beautiful colonial architecture and traditional balconies.  Continue through the modern districts of San Isidro and Miraflores, including the Olive Grove, Central Park and main shopping areas.

    Day 10: Lima – Cusco – Sacsayhuaman  After breakfast, transfer to the airport for your flight to Cusco. Upon arrival, transfer to your hotel.
    In the afternoon, explore the archaeological sites surrounding Cusco, including Tambomachay, Qenqo, Sacsayhuaman and Puca Pucara. At Sacsayhuaman, admire the enormous stone constructions and panoramic views over Cusco.

    Day 11: Machu Picchu  After breakfast, take the scenic train through the Sacred Valley to Aguas Calientes, followed by a short bus ride to Machu Picchu.  Enjoy a guided tour of this remarkable Inca citadel, dramatically situated among the mountains. After lunch, return by train to Cusco and transfer to your hotel.

    Day 12: Cusco – Puno  After breakfast, travel by scenic bus from Cusco to Puno, with cultural and historical stops along the way, including Pikillaqta, Andahuaylillas and Raqchi.  Enjoy lunch in Sicuani before continuing to La Raya Pass, at approximately 4,200 metres, where the landscape changes dramatically. Continue to Puno and transfer to your hotel.

    Day 13: Puno – Lake Titicaca – Lima  After breakfast, take a boat across Lake Titicaca to visit the famous Uros Floating Islands, traditionally constructed from totora reeds.  Continue to Taquile Island, known for its traditional weaving, welcoming communities and beautiful countryside. After the excursion, transfer to Juliaca Airport for your flight to Lima, followed by a transfer to your hotel.

    Day 14: Lima – Home  After breakfast, transfer to the airport for your international flight back home, taking with you wonderful memories of Brazil, Argentina and Peru.
